OverviewTransaction Network Services (TNS), a Koch Industries company, is seeking a talented and motivated Technical Project Manager who will be working remotely. The Project Management area is responsible for leading cross-functional teams to achieve the project goals and requirements. Work with project teams and stakeholders to plan, execute, monitor, and control the project. Manage resources, budget, cost, time, quality, risks, and other constraints.ResponsibilitiesRespons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Creating and executing Project Plans, Meeting Agendas/Minutes and Status Reports; escalating when appropriate to deliver project tasks on time;
- Identifying resources needed and managing assigned resources, including 3rd party Field Technicians;
- Managing day-to-day operational aspects of a project and scope;
- Effectively applying PMO methodology and enforcing the TNS Operational Readiness standards;
- Managing multiple projects at once with one week to multi-month life cycles.
- Collaborating with network engineers, datacenter technicians, clients, and internal stakeholders;
- Working with TNS's vendors to ensure timely delivery of ordered services;
- Ensuring project documents are complete, current, and stored appropriately.
- Tracking risks and creating contingency plans.
Minimum qualifications:
- Very good spoken and written English;
- 4-5 years of Technical Project Management experience in the IT/Telecom industry;
- Desired qualifications: experience with datacenter infrastructure deployments, PMP certification;
- Team player;
- Fast learner, self-sufficient, work with minimal supervision;
- Hard-working;
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
